Output 2e33107cd56bf75d5186b5dc8f7baecf615a43deafb8da2b485c2b0a0c9ebf33:89

value
1301126
script pubkey
OP_0 OP_PUSHBYTES_20 ba0cc9eae010ea46c71839383568066c8e67b09a
address
bc1qhgxvn6hqzr4yd3cc8yur26qxdj8x0vy6j9vlt9
transaction
2e33107cd56bf75d5186b5dc8f7baecf615a43deafb8da2b485c2b0a0c9ebf33
spent
true